A binary solid (A+ B-) has a zinc blende structure with B- ions constituting the lattice and A+ ions occupying 25% of the tetrahedral holes. The formula of the solid is

Detailed Solution

Suppose the number of B- ions that constitute the lattice is 100.
The number of tetrahedral sites = 200.
Of these, 25% are occupied by A+. Therefore, the number of A+ = 50.
So, the ratio of A+ : B = 50 : 100 = 1 : 2.
The formula is AB2.
